Green Roofs For Temperature Control

Green roofs are effective in controlling temperature by providing insulation, reducing heat transfer and absorbing sunlight. London can become more sustainable by implementing green roofs in buildings as a way to combat the urban heat island effect. The use of green roofs can reduce energy consumption within buildings by reducing the need for air conditioning during summer months. Moreover, green roofs can provide a carbon sink by sequestering carbon dioxide from the atmosphere. Green roofs also reduce stormwater runoff pressure and improve urban biodiversity by providing habitats for wildlife. To ensure the effectiveness of green roofs, urban planning policies can mandate their inclusion in new buildings and incentivize retrofitting of existing buildings with green roofs. The London Green Roof Report provides guidelines on best practices on implementing green roofs, including substrate depths, plant selections and maintenance. The report also highlights key benefits of green roofs such as reduce waste to landfill, air and water pollution and enhancing mental health and wellbeing. With a strategic approach, London can use green roofs to sustainably manage built environments, mitigate environmental impacts and achieve greener cities for future generations.

Solar Energy For Electricity Generation

London can become more sustainable by harnessing the power of solar energy for electricity generation. Solar energy is a renewable source of energy that is freely available and emits no greenhouse gases.

To use solar energy for electricity generation, photovoltaic panels can be installed on rooftops or in open spaces. These panels consist of solar cells that convert sunlight into electricity. The electricity can be used directly, stored in batteries or fed into the grid.

London has a lot of potential to generate solar energy due to the city’s vast urban landscape. By implementing solar energy systems across the city, London can reduce its dependence on non-renewable energy sources and decrease greenhouse gas emissions.

Moreover, the installation of solar panels can also enhance the energy efficiency of buildings. Buildings that use solar panels can save energy consumption and ultimately reduce energy costs in the long run.

In conclusion, the adoption of solar energy for electricity generation can help London on its path to becoming a more sustainable city. With the right policies and incentives, many homes and businesses can install solar energy systems, thereby increasing the city’s renewable energy output and decreasing its carbon footprint.

Water Conservation Through Design

Water conservation through design is a crucial aspect of sustainable development, and London can become more sustainable by implementing various strategies to conserve water. Firstly, designing buildings with efficient water systems, such as greywater recycling and rainwater harvesting, can significantly reduce water usage. Secondly, promoting low-water landscaping and vegetation in urban areas can minimize the need for irrigation. Thirdly, encouraging the use of water-efficient fixtures and appliances, such as low-flow showerheads and toilets, can also contribute to water conservation.

Another way to promote water conservation through design is to create communal areas that capture rainwater for use in communal amenities such as toilets and irrigation. Furthermore, green roofs and walls can improve the natural water cycle by absorbing water and reducing the risk of flooding while reducing runoff.

Overall, water conservation through design can have a significant impact on reducing water usage and promoting more sustainable practices. By implementing these strategies, London can become more sustainable and lead the way in sustainable urban design.

Passive Design For Natural Lighting

Passive design for natural lighting is an effective way to reduce energy consumption and increase sustainability in urban areas like London. To encourage passive design, building codes and regulations could be implemented that require buildings to use natural light as much as possible.

Some strategies for passive design include designing buildings with large windows and skylights, using light shelves to reflect and diffuse light throughout a space, and utilizing light wells and atriums to bring light into the center of a building. Additionally, building orientation can be optimized to increase the amount of sunlight a building receives throughout the day.

Energy-Efficient Lighting Systems

Energy-efficient lighting systems can significantly contribute to London’s sustainability goals. Replacing conventional light bulbs with LED lights can lead to significant energy savings while reducing the city’s carbon footprint. Retrofitting existing street lights with LED bulbs can also be a cost-effective way to improve lighting efficiency.

In addition, installing motion sensors and automatic lighting controls in buildings can considerably reduce energy consumption by only lighting areas when needed. This approach can also provide a more comfortable and safer environment for occupants.

To further promote energy-efficient lighting systems adoption, the city can launch awareness campaigns to educate citizens about the benefits of using LED light bulbs and how they can access them. Additionally, the city can provide incentives and subsidies to encourage businesses and residents to invest in energy-efficient lighting systems.

In conclusion, energy-efficient lighting systems are essential in the pursuit of a sustainable London. Reducing energy consumption can lead to significant cost savings and improve air quality. Proper Waste Management Systems

Proper waste management systems are critical for making London a more sustainable city. One potential solution is to encourage the use of composting programs, which can convert organic waste into nutrient-rich soil. Additionally, London could implement a pay-as-you-throw program, in which households are charged based on the amount of waste they produce, thus incentivizing individuals to reduce their waste. Furthermore, London could invest in recycling infrastructure, such as sorting centers and material recovery facilities, to maximize the amount of waste diverted from landfills. The city could also explore the feasibility of waste-to-energy systems, which convert waste into electricity, reducing the need for fossil fuels. Finally, public education campaigns could raise awareness about the importance of reducing, reusing, and recycling waste, and encourage individuals to adopt sustainable practices. By implementing these measures, London could significantly lower its carbon footprint, improve its environmental sustainability, and set an example for other cities to follow.

One of the key steps towards a more sustainable London is reducing car usage. Private transport is responsible for a significant amount of pollution and greenhouse gas emissions, making it a major contributor to climate change. London has already introduced measures such as congestion charges, the ultra-low emission zone, and expanding cycle and walking routes, which have had some success. However, further investment in public transport, such as expanding the tube network and promoting electric buses, could significantly reduce reliance on private transport.

Increasing recycling rates is also crucial in promoting sustainability in London. Currently, only a fraction of waste is recycled, with a large percentage ending up in landfills. The city must adopt more innovative waste management solutions, such as food waste collections, to help reduce carbon emissions and improve air quality.

Green investment incentives are also needed to promote sustainability in London. The city must encourage businesses to invest in renewable energy sources such as wind and solar power, by providing financial incentives such as tax breaks and subsidies. This would not only reduce carbon emissions but also create new jobs and stimulate the local economy.
